Baton Rouge had an estimated 888,699 residents in the Census Bureau Vintage 2025 estimates, placing the metro second in Louisiana. The figure establishes guide selection, not project demand.
The FAA places Baton Rouge Metropolitan Airport four miles north of downtown in Class C airspace. Commercial traffic shares the environment with local and transient general aviation, air taxi, and military operations. Current charts and NOTAMs remain necessary.
The Port of Greater Baton Rouge links deepwater docks with truck, rail, and barge access near I-10 and LA 1. That network supports industrial receiving plans, but final routing and site permission remain location-specific. The site survey checklist records those boundaries before aircraft comparison begins.
The FAA BTR briefing identifies a complex taxiway intersection west of the active runways. Closed Runway 4R/22L remains shown on the airport diagram, and construction is ongoing. Static airport familiarity cannot replace the current NOTAM package.
Baton Rouge 1991-2020 climate normals show 61.94 inches of annual precipitation. Normal highs reach 90.5 degrees in June, 91.9 in July, and 92.2 in August. Project-day wind, visibility, surface condition, and aircraft performance determine whether a window works.
A City-Parish construction permit is required for road or lane closures associated with work, including deliveries. Requests should arrive at least seven days before the closure, and signing must follow MUTCD requirements. Traffic permission does not grant control of airspace or private property.

The port’s Deepwater Complex publishes 3,000 feet of deepwater docks with truck, rail, barge, and deepwater access. I-10 and LA 1 are the identified highway connections.
The Inland Rivers Marine Terminal has a 300-foot concrete bulkhead plus truck, rail, and barge access near the Gulf Intracoastal Waterway. These are regional access facts, not confirmation that a receiving area is open or suitable.
